I used the Stampin’ Up! Hand-Penned Petals Photopolymer Stamp Set along with the Hand-Penned Designer Series Paper for my card today.

Here is our sketch for this week.

I started by adhering a panel of Hand Penned DSP to a Garden Green card base. On a panel of Basic White cardstock I stamped the outline floral image from the Hand-Penned Petals stamp set in Tuxedo Black Ink. I adhered a Post-It note to the panel and stamped the floral image once. I flipped the panel over and adhered the Post-It note again and stamped the floral image a second time. I stamped the leaves in Garden Green Ink. I stamped the flowers in Daffodil Delight, Highland Heather and Pool Party Inks.

I embossed the panel using my Timeworn Type 3d Embossing Folder. I stamped the sentiment from the Stampin’ Up! Cactus Cuties Photopolymer Stamp Set in Versamark Ink on a panel of Garden Green cardstock. I immediately sprinkled it with my White Embossing Powder and set it using my Heat Tool. I cut the sentiment out using my Waves Dies.

I threaded White Bakers Twine through the sentiment and adhered it to the back with Stampin’ Seal. I adhered the artwork to the card front using Stampin’ Dimensionals. I added a couple Brushed Brass Butterflies and a Bumblebee Trinket to the card front.

On the inside I stamped the sentiment from the Hand-Penned Petals stamp set in Tuxedo Black Ink on a Basic White panel. I stamped the outlined floral image from the Hand-Penned Petals stamp set on the bottom of the panel. I stamped the leaves in Gaden Green Ink and the flowers in Daffodil Delight, Highland Heather and Pool Party Inks. I adhered the Basic White panel to a Garden Green mat and then to the inside of the Garden Green card base.

To complete my card, I decorated a Basic White Medium Envelope. I stamped the outlined floral image from the Hand Penned Petals stamp set on the envelope front in Tuxedo Black Ink. I stamped the leaves and flowers the same as i did for the card front. I adhered a panel of Hand Penned DSP to the envelope flap.

I used the Stampin’ Up! Create With Friends Photopolymer Stamp Set, the Stampin’ Up! Hand-Penned Petals Bundle and the Hand-Penned Designer Series Paper.

I started by scoring the card base at 4 1/4″ & 5 1/2″. I then scored from the bottom of the 4 1/4″ score line to the top right corner and folded the panel in. I adhered the left binder side together using Multipurpose Liquid Glue. I adhered a strip of the Hand-Penned DSP to the left side of the card front using Multipurpose Liquid Glue.

I cut a panel of Basic White cardstock using the largest die from the Scalloped Contours Dies. I moved the die down 3 scallops and cut again to make a square. I adhered a panel of Hand-Penned DSP to the scallop square using Multipurpose Liquid Glue. I adhered the layered panel to a Mint Macaron mat using Stampin’ Seal. I adhered the panel just to the bottom triangle of the card base using Multipurpose Liquid Glue.

On a strip of Basic White cardstock I stamped the sentiment from the Create With Friends stamp set in Mint Macaron Ink. I edged the sentiment using my Blushing Bride Stampin’ Write Marker. On a thin scrap of Basic White cardstock I stamped the sentiment from the Create With Friends stamp set in Blushing Bride Ink and adhered it to the top of the larger sentiment using Mini Stampin’ Dimensionals. I adhered the sentiment to the card front using Stampin’ Dimensionals. I added a few Genial Gems to the card front.

On the inside I stamped the sentiment from the Stampin’ Up! Hand-Penned Petals Photopolymer Stamp Set in Mint Macaron Ink on a Basic White panel. I adhered the panel to a Mint Macaron mat using Stampin’ Seal and then to the inside of the Mint Macaron card base using Multipurpose Liquid Glue. I cut the detailed floral die from from a panel of Blushing Bride cardstock using the Penned Flowers Dies. I adhered the die cut to the inside panel using Stampin’ Dimensionals, placing it on the corner to hold the easel open.

To finish my card I decorated a Basic White Medium Envelope. I stamped the large floral image from the Hand-Penned Petals stamp set in Smoky Slate Ink on the envelope front. I adhered a panel of the Hand-Penned DSP to the envelope flap.

I used the Stampin’ Up! Hand-Penned Suite for my corner fold card today. Stampin’ Up! has simplified purchasing for you. There is one number for the Hand-Penned Petals Bundle, Hand-Penned Designer Series Paper and the Genial Gems. These products can be found on page 104/105 of the 2021-2022 Annual Catalog.

I started by adhering a panel of the Hand-Penned DSP to the front of a Misty Moonlight card base using Stampin’ Seal. I placed the bottom edge of my card on the bottom edge of my Trimmer at the 3″ mark. I placed the cutting blade at the 2 1/2″ mark and cut up to the 4 7/8″ mark. I turned the card a 1/4 turn, placing the front right side of the card on the bottom edge of the trimmer at the 3″ mark. I cut from the 3″ mark down to the 5/8″ mark. Very gently and slowly push the bottom cut edge through the back to flip around to the top. The DSP side will now be on the inside.

I embossed a small panel of Pale Papaya cardstock using the Checks & Dots Embossing Folder and adhered it to the flipped panel using Multipurpose Liquid Glue. On a panel of Basic White cardstock I stamped the floral image from the Stampin’ Up! Hand-Penned Petals Stamp Set in Tuxedo Black Ink. I stamped the fill images in Garden Green Ink, stamped off once, Misty Moonlight Ink, stamped off once and Pale Papaya Ink over the outlined image. I cut the image out using my Penned Flowers Dies. I cut a few of the detailed leaves from the Penned Flowers Dies from a panel of Mint Macaron cardstock and adhered them to the back of the die cut flowers using Glue Dots.

I adhered the bouquet to the embossed panel using Stampin’ Dimensionals. I adhered a piece of the Pale Papaya 1/2″ Woven Ribbon to the bottom of the card front with a tiny amount of Stampin’ Seal. On a small panel of Basic White cardstock I stamped the sentiment from the Hand-Penned Petals stamp set in Misty Moonlight Ink. I cut the sentiment out using my Stitched So Sweetly Dies and adhered it over the ribbon using Stampin’ Dimensionals. I added a few Genial Gems to the card front.

I adhered a panel of Hand-Penned DSP to the inside of the Misty Moonlight card base using Stampin’ Seal. On a panel of Basic White cardstock I stamped the sentiment from the Stampin’ Up! Inspired Thoughts Cling Stamp Set in Misty Moonlight Ink. I stamped a partial image of the flowers from the Hand-Penned Petals stamp set in Tuxedo Black Ink on the bottom corner of the panel. I stamped the fill images in Garden Green Ink, stamped off once, Misty Moonlight Ink, stamped off once and Pale Papaya Ink over the outlined image. I adhered the Basic White panel to the DSP panel using Multipurpose Liquid Glue, making sure it would be behind the card front.

To finish my card I decorated a Basic White Medium Envelope. I stamped a partial flower image from the Hand-Penned Petals stamp set in Tuxedo Black Ink on the envelope front. I stamped the fill images in the same as I did for the card. I adhered a panel of the Hand-Penned DSP to the envelope flap.

I used the Stampin’ Up! Hand-Penned Petals Photopolymer Stamp Set along with the Hand-Penned Designer Series Paper. Here is my card for today.

My team leader, Jaimie, is giving us weekly challenges to do. There’s a color challenge and sketch challenge. We could use either of both. This was last weeks challenge and I used both.

I started by adhering a panel of the Hand-Penned DSP to a Highland Heather card base using Multipurpose Liquid Glue.

I stamped the sentiment from the Hand-Penned Petals stamp set in Tuxedo Black Ink on a panel of Hand-Penned DSP. I adhered the DSP to 2 strips of Mint Macaron cardstock using Stampin’ Seal.

I cut a panel of Highland Heather cardstock using one of the Tasteful Labels Dies. I adhered the Highland Heather banner to the card front using Multipurpose Liquid Glue. I adhered the DSP panel to the card front using Stampin’ Dimensionals. I tied a small bow using the Fresh Freesia 3/8″ Open Weave Ribbon and adhered it using a Glue Dot. I added a few Fresh Freesia 2021-2023 In-Color Jewels to the card front.

On the inside I stamped the sentiment from the Stampin’ Up! Ornate Thanks Photopolymer Stamp Set in Tuxedo Black Ink on a Basic White panel. I adhered a strip of the Hand-Penned DSP to the bottom of the panel using Stampin’ Seal. I adhered the Basic White panel to a Mint Macaron mat using Stampin’ Seal and then to the inside of the Highland Heather card base using Multipurpose Liquid Glue.

To finish my card I decorated a Basic White Medium Envelope. I adhered a strip of the Hand-Penned DSP to the envelope front and a panel to the envelope flap.

I used the Stampin’ Up! Hand-Penned Petals Bundle (available May 4th). I was inspired by the beautiful spring flowers and colors in the bouquet for my Clean and Layered card. My design is from Hand Stamped Sentiments Challenge #362.

I hope you will take a moment to visit The Card Concept and join us this week to play along with our challenge #154. How are you inspired by this photo?

I started by adhering a panel of the retiring Brights 6 X 6 Designer Series Paper to a Thick Basic White card base using Multipurpose Liquid Glue.

I cut a panel of Basic White cardstock using the Stitched Rectangle Dies then embossed is using the Painted Texture 3D Embossing Folder. I adhered the panel to the card front using Multipurpose Liquid Glue. On a panel of Basic White cardstock I stamped the large flower image from the Stampin’ Up! Hand-Penned Petals Photopolymer Stamp Set in Tuxedo Black Ink. I stamped the individual flower and leaf images from the Hand-Penned Petals stamp set in Daffodil Delight, Mint Macaron, Pacific Point and Polished Pink. I cut the image out using my Penned Flowers Dies (available May 4th).

Using the Penned Flowers Dies, I cut some of the leaves out of a panel of Garden Green cardstock and adhered them to the back of the bouquet using Glue Dots. I adhered a length of the Silver trim from the Simply Elegant Trim (available May 4th) using a little Stampin’ Seal to hold it in place. I adhered the bouquet to the card front using Stampin’ Dimensionals. I added a few Rhinestone Basic Jewels to some of the flower centers. I stamped the sentiment from the Stampin’ Up! Dressed To Impress Photopolymer Stamp Set in Pacific Point Ink and adhered it to the floral image using a Glue Dot and Stampin’ Dimensional.

On the inside I stamped the sentiment from the Stampin’ Up! Simply Succulent Cling Stamp Set in Pacific Point in the center of Basic White panel. I had stamped the floral image from the Hand-Penned Petals stamp set in Tuxedo Black Ink on a panel of Basic White cardstock and colored it in, but decided not to use it. I cut the image out using the detailed floral die from the Penned Flowers Dies and adhered it to the bottom of the panel using Multipurpose Liquid Glue. I adhered the Basic White panel to a Pacific Point mat using Stampin’ Seal then adhered it to the inside of the Thick Basic White card base using Stampin’ Seal.

To complete my card I decorated a Basic White Medium Envelope. I stamped the floral image from the Hand-Penned Petals stamp set in Tuxedo Black Ink on the envelope front. I stamped the solid flower and leaf images in Daffodil Delight, Mint Maccaron, Pacific Point and Polished Pink Inks. I adhered a panel of the Brights DSP to the envelope flap.
